May 02, 2022
SYA Admissions is a high-energy, fast-paced and creative department that enrolls nearly 200 students every year to attend our schools in France, Italy and Spain either for the year or the semester. The Admissions Marketing Manager is a key member of the Admissions team in developing and executing creative programs and campaigns to attract and enroll students. Key duties: o Develop and manage annual admissions marketing plan to include direct email, social media and other virtual events. o Serve as the webmaster for the Admissions team, keeper of the SYA brand files and SYA Google photo drive. o Brainstorm creative ways to partner and engage young alumni for the Admissions Ambassador program. o Draft and run workflows using HubSpot emails and texts, for students, parents and teachers. o Run key conversion programs such as the Campus Reporter program, which includes selection of reporters at each campus as well as oversight of content generation, and yield program. o...
School Year Abroad
North Andover, Massachusetts, MA